The Canadian Securities Administrators (CSA) has published proposed amendments to National Instrument 45-106 Prospectus Exemptions and changes to the Companion Policy 45-106P (the Proposed Amendments), for a 90-day comment period ending October 21, 2026.
The Proposed Amendments seek to codify increases to the amount of funds that qualified listed issuers can raise without a prospectus. They primarily focus on the 2025 blanket order (the Blanket Order) that increased the amount that can be raised under the Listed Issuer Financing Exemption (LIFE), from a maximum of $10 million to $25 million – or up to $50 million for larger companies – in a 12-month period, subject to conditions.
The Proposed Amendments also respond to feedback received from certain market participants by streamlining other conditions of the exemption.
